Crunchy Asian Kale and Cabbage Salad with Sesame Dressing

Side Dish5 min204 cal / serving

This vibrant salad is a far cry from ordinary greens. It features a medley of crunchy textures-three kinds of cabbage, tender kale, sweet carrots, toasted cashews and crispy sesame sticks-all coated in a lightly sweet dressing.

Serve it alongside your favorite main dish, add cooked chicken or shrimp for a heartier dinner or pack it for a quick lunch. It comes together in just minutes and is sure to become a go-to.

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Empty the salad kit contents into a large bowl.
  2. Drizzle with dressing to your preference, then toss well to coat evenly.

Recipe Tips

For extra protein, top with grilled chicken or shrimp.

Let the dressed salad sit for 5 minutes to allow flavors to meld.

FAQ

Can I make this salad ahead of time?

It’s best enjoyed immediately after tossing, but you can prep the dry ingredients and dressing separately and combine just before serving.

What can I add to make it a full meal?

Add cooked chicken, shrimp or tofu for protein or serve alongside grilled fish or steak.

How should I store leftovers?

Store undressed salad mix in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 2 days. Add dressing only when ready to eat.
